MOUNT HERBERT.
The monthly meeting of the Mount Herbert County Council took place on Monday at the Council Chambers, Purau. Present: Messrs Orton Bradley (chairman), G. Steel, L. M. Wilson. Q. C. Manson, J. Hunter, J. A. j Gellety, and It. Allan. The chair- | man reported that he had visited all ' the plantations, and found them doing well. Hβ had selected several other spots that could be planted this winter with advantage, if the Council gave him permission to do so. The chairman was thanked for the trouble that he had tnken in the matter, and per-, mission was given for additional plant-' ins. It was resolved to re-deck the bridge at Tedtlington. The clerk reported that the acquisition of the land at Teddington for a -workman's cottage and pound had advanced another step, and would soon be gazetted. He had only been able to devote one day to collecting for the Belgian Fund, and , had collected or been promised upwards j of £200. The clerk was urged to com- j pleto collecting as soon as possible. j
